“How do two brothers get into the nail care business?” This is the single most common question people ask us. There’s a long and rocky version but we’ll give you the short one. We have our fearless and unconventional mother, Young Salo, to thank. With a single-minded entrepreneurial spirit, she decided to start her own business at the age of 49. She had a passion for the nail industry and we did everything in our power to support her. In the end, this is a family business.

Greg, the older brother, became a licensed nail technician after switching gears from fire fighter’s training. He is energy personified and has a true passion for developing the best professional nail care products and education. Habib is the younger brother. He jumped in a few years later; taking a detour from medical school and a life in music. He brings his own creative mind for business, marketing and strategy. Unexpectedly, we are a perfect team.

Today, more than 20 years later, Young Nails Inc., is a professional nail care manufacturing company exporting to over 40 countries worldwide and distributing domestically to over 3000 stores. We’re respected for our next-level product innovation and education. Our mission is to bring you the best quality products and we’ll show you how to use them with incredible results. Most cleansers contains isopropyl alcohol and acetone so I make my own by using 70-80% alcohol (amount not alcohol percentage) and 20-30% acetone and that works great for me! 😊 and I don't know why but I have never had any problems with either top coat or gel polish chipping even if I buff the surface really smooth, maybe I have just been lucky 😆
I love all your tips and tricks, they're really good! ❤
I also use a 150 grit hand file when I'm prepping and that has changed the longevity of my nails! I used to buff because that's what I was taught, then someone told me that it actually makes the nails too smooth for the gel to grip on to the nails and I got a "A-ha" moment 😂 after I changed to a file I noticed a massive difference!! 😃🥰

Now a days everyone is washing there hands a lot and using sanitizer. Because of this I’ve changed the soap I use for clients to wash there hands. Another tech told me if you are using soap with moisturizers it can act like a barrier on the nail plate which can lead to lifting. So I changed this with my prep and it helps.
